Chapter 192: Historical Legacy Issues

Alyssa knows Lin Qiu.

So she knew that as long as she told Lin Qiu the truth of what happened nine years ago, the entire imperial capital would be in trouble the next day, but she also knew that even if she didn't say it, there would be a series of "insiders" who came out of nowhere and accidentally told Lin Qiu the news he wanted to know.

Lin Qiu always had a way to find out what he wanted to know.

In order to prevent someone from deliberately distorting the truth of the incident nine years ago, Alyssa felt that it was better to tell Lin Qiu by herself. After all, as a person who has personally experienced the events of that year, her objective notarization may be second only to Captain Dragonfly.

To summarize the whole incident briefly and implicitly, it is probably that the plebeian class at that time was instigated to rise up overnight, occupying all areas of the imperial capital and the Church, and the spearhead was directly aimed at the regime of Henry V. The fundamental reason for their success was that the vast majority of the soldiers in the army at that time were also dissatisfied with Henry V's policy of placing them, and participated in the coup d'Γ©tat, becoming accomplices of the civilian class.

When the church received the news of the royal family's request for help, it was late at night, and the city was full of riots and fires. Henry V immediately sent a letter to the Senate asking for help, hoping that the Church would send troops to keep them safe before the Senate troops arrived. At that time, the only army stationed near the church was Melia, and the two of them were knights of the church before they set out.

Before fully understanding the situation, she and Melia were tasked with guarding the palace and trying to avoid clashes with civilians and the army.

In terms of numbers, the royal family was at an absolute disadvantage, and the bishop, on the one hand, feared that the situation would worsen, and on the other hand, suspected that the uprising was not accidental, but was planned. The Church received information that there had been a simultaneous rebellion in four different districts, and that the rebels had quickly taken over the main transportation routes in each district, sealing off all areas.

Another reason why the imperial capital got out of control overnight was also the policy of Henry V's wars.

The nobles had far enough knights to fill the void on the frontal battlefield, and they needed more men to fend off the Iron Cavalry of the Byron Empire. In the midst of many opposition, Henry V resolutely introduced a series of policies, including the fact that any gifted child is eligible to enter the knight's academy, and for those from poor families, the royal family will also waive all tuition fees, and the only requirement is that they must be conscripted into the army after graduation.

This policy largely compensated for the lack of front-line soldiers, and it took four years to train a knight capable of fighting, and in the nearly 20 years since the policy was implemented, the composition of the army has gradually changed from nobles to commoners. In addition to important positions such as Master Chief and Commander, the vast majority of soldiers come from the civilian class.

It was the end of the war when Alyssa was admitted to the Furnace Academy, and Henry V did not expect the war to end so quickly that a series of wartime policies that had been used to inspire him could not be realized.

One of the most important is that the soldiers returning from victory can stay in the imperial capital and receive knighthoods, and this unattainable edict is the main irreconcilable contradiction between the two sides.

Cold and famine were the last straw that crushed civilians, destroying what little patience they had left.

"It was the last war I ever had. Alyssa recalled.

It's just that the enemy on the battlefield has changed from the iron cavalry of the Byron Empire to the teammates who fought side by side in the past. Within a short distance from the church to the palace, more than ten of her troops left and joined the rebels. On the battlefield, only two are unshakable.

Position, and Beliefs.

The defense of the palace can only be described as a meat grinder, after a night of fierce fighting, the corpses blocked the mountain road leading to the royal family, and the walls in front of the palace were stained red with blood.

"You don't want to know what it was like. Alyssa said.

It was not only the rebels who died, but also many middle and low-class nobles living in the four major cities, and after the rebels occupied the area, in order to coerce Henry V to sign a treaty, they took all the nobles as hostages and brought them to the palace. After losing the siege, the rebels became angry and agitated, and executed all the hostages at dawn in front of the palace defenders.

Even in this case, the order received by Alyssa and the others was still to "protect the royal family and not to leave the city".

The bishop preferred that the Senate would have intervened to settle the matter, and as we all know, the Senate's approach to insurrection was a complete eradication.

The Church does not want to wade into these troubled waters, and does not want its painstaking image to collapse because of the inhumane massacre.

"Melia did the work of the 'wicked' in place of the Senate?" Lin Qiu guessed.

"To protect Princess Sophia. ”

Alyssa didn't know much about what happened next. All she knew was that Princess Sophia, after witnessing the execution of the hostages in front of the royal city, sneaked out of King Henry's secret and tried to negotiate with the leader of the rebel army. After learning the news, the bishop reluctantly ordered Melia to secretly go out of the city alone and bring Princess Sophia back.

And then it wasn't just Alyssa, but the rest of the church was also informed.

In the process of rescuing Sofia, Melia slaughtered nearly half of the rebels in the city, and later death statistics showed that not only soldiers but also the elderly, women, and children were killed. Apparently she had gone beyond the limits of a Church knight, but more importantly, she had violated one of the most important treaties that the Church had to banish her.

Templars are not allowed to go into battle.

This is an iron law set by St. Gosya herself.

As a popular candidate for the Knights of the Round Table, Melia had reached the threshold of the Templars before Alyssa, but the timing of her display was so special that the Church had to expel her.

Later, the rebel leader was identified as a commoner named Canor, who had been a wealthy merchant who had exhausted all his assets by helping the poor, and even many soldiers had benefited from him to a greater or lesser extent, which gave him a high status in the civilian class. ”

Carnor did not come to a happy end, and like the rest of the rebels, he died easily at the hands of Melia.

"Wait a minute, the orphan of sinners who rebelled against the royal family, should it refer to ......?" Lin Qiu was stunned.

"It is true that some say that Canor once adopted a girl, that she was missing after Canor's death, and that she died at the hands of Melia, as did Canor. ”

"Melia thinks that person is Ella?"

"I don't know...... But if Melia is so sure, there shouldn't be anything wrong with that. Melia's best skills on the battlefield are tracking and assassination. ”

That is to say...... Ella is in trouble. ”
